As you can see, compliance officers represent the largest segment of the compliance workforce, with a 45% share. These professionals typically oversee the development and implementation of comprehensive compliance programs. Their expertise in regulatory requirements, risk management, and internal controls makes them indispensable to organisations seeking to maintain a strong compliance posture. Compliance analysts account for 30% of the workforce. These specialists are responsible for monitoring, reviewing, and testing adherence to internal policies and external regulations. Their analytical skills and keen attention to detail enable them to identify potential compliance issues before they escalate into costly problems. Compliance managers make up 15% of the sector. As strategic leaders, they are responsible for establishing and maintaining an organisation's overall compliance framework. Their role requires a deep understanding of regulatory requirements, industry best practices, and the ability to communicate complex compliance concepts to diverse stakeholders. Finally, compliance consultants comprise 10% of the compliance workforce. These independent professionals provide guidance and advice to organisations seeking to enhance their compliance programs. By leveraging their expertise in various compliance domains, they help businesses navigate the complex regulatory landscape and minimise risks.
